TRuE AD2 - An Efficacy and Safety Study of Ruxolitinib Cream in Adolescents and Adults With Atopic Dermatitis
Topical Ruxolitinib Evaluation in Atopic Dermatitis Study 2 (TRuE AD2) - A Phase 3, Double-Blind, Randomized, 8-Week, Vehicle-Controlled Efficacy and Safety Study of Ruxolitinib Cream Followed by a Long-Term Safety Extension Period in Adolescents and Adults With Atopic Dermatitis
Sponsor: Incyte Corporation
A PHASE3 clinical study on Atopic Dermatitis, this trial is completed. The trial is conducted by Incyte Corporation and has accumulated 13 data snapshots since 2018. Longitudinal tracking of this trial contributes to a broader understanding of treatment development timelines.
